java生成四则运算表达式_生成四则运算(java实现)
|博客班级 | https://edu.cnblogs.com/campus/ahgc/AHPU-SE-19/ |
|作业要求 | https://edu.cnblogs.com/campus/ahgc/AHPU-SE-19/homework/11376|
|作业目标 | 写一个能自动生成小学四则运算题目的程序 |
|学号 | 3190704130 |
代码如下:
//main函数所在区域主要实现生成问题
`package xiaohu;
import java.util.Scanner;
public class CT {
public static String str = "";
public static int num = 5;
public static int num_i = 0;
public static int numberRange = 100;
public static double sum = 0;
public static void main(String[] args) {
System.out.println("当然是小胡啦");
System.out.println("控制台实现出题判断");
System.out.println("注意:结果保留1位小数!");
System.out.println("共10道题目:");
Scanner in = new Scanner(System.in);
double answer = 0;
double result = 0;
String[] question = new String[10];
int questionNumber = 0;
int answerTrue = 0;
boolean flag;
for(;
java生成四则运算表达式_生成四则运算(java实现)相关推荐
- 如何在Java中使用表达式_如何在java中计算表达式?
我在快速谷歌后发现了这段代码: import java.util.Stack; /** * Class to evaluate infix and postfix expressions. * * @ ...
- java生成算数表达式_惊!小学生要失业了,Java实现生成并计算四则运算表达式。...
githup传送门:https://github.com/Bubblegod/FormulationCalculation 项目成员:梁竞 袁智杰 1.项目要求 题目:实现一个自动生成小学四则运算题目 ...
- 栈运算 java_栈的应用——四则运算表达式求值(Java实现)
首先介绍几个概念 中缀式:平常我们所用到的标准的四则运算表达式就是中缀式,如9+(3-1)*3+10/2,这就是一个中缀式 后缀式(逆波兰式):一种不需要括号的后缀表达法,我们也把他称为逆波兰式,如将 ...
- eclipse编译java项目class文件_动态编译 Java 代码以及生成 Jar 文件
导读: 最近在看 Flink 源码的时候发现到一段实用的代码,该代码实现了 java 动态编译以及生成 jar 文件.将其进行改进后可以应用到我们的平台上,实现在平台页面上编写 java 代码语句,提 ...
- java获取机器号_(转)JAVA获得机器码的实现
http://yangshangchuan.iteye.com/blog/2012401 首先,定义了一个统一的接口,以支持不同操作系统不同实现的透明切换: Java代码 收藏代码 /** *生成机 ...
- java虚拟机编译顺序_深入理解Java虚拟机(程序编译与代码优化)
文章首发于微信公众号:BaronTalk,欢迎关注! 对于性能和效率的追求一直是程序开发中永恒不变的宗旨,除了我们自己在编码过程中要充分考虑代码的性能和效率,虚拟机在编译阶段也会对代码进行优化.本文就 ...
- java 内部类 加载_举例讲解Java的内部类与类的加载器
内部类 class A { //Inner1 要在 A 初始化后 才能使用,即要被A的对象所调用 class Inner1 { int k = 0; // static int j = 0; //A加 ...
- 深入理解Java虚拟机知乎_深入理解Java虚拟机(类文件结构)
深入理解Java虚拟机(类文件结构) 欢迎关注微信公众号:BaronTalk,获取更多精彩好文! 之前在阅读 ASM 文档时,对于已编译类的结构.方法描述符.访问标志.ACC_PUBLIC.ACC_P ...
- java程序性能优化_怎么做JAVA程序性能优化
展开全部 1)尽量指定类.方62616964757a686964616fe59b9ee7ad9431333433623731法的final修饰符.带有final修饰符的类是不可派生的,Java编译器会 ...
最新文章
- BottomNavigationView+ViewPager+Fragment仿微信底部导航栏
- CF1038D Slime 构造
- BlockingQueue常用方法add、off、put、take、poll使用说明
- uinty粒子系统子物体变大_Unity的粒子系统(一)基础篇
- (一)通过深度学习进行COVID-19诊断
- python有多少种语法_这20个常规Python语法你都搞明白了吗?
- Stm32 CubeMx安装和配置Cube.ai教程
- Linux如何修改makefile文件,linux中Makefile的使用
- 解决android Studio 安装完运行提示failed to find build tools revision 24.0.2
- re学习笔记(71)大吉杯DJBCTF - re - 部分WP
- APP原型设计利器-墨刀MockingBot
- linux查进程ps和top,linux进程查看top与ps
- android手机拍摄视频格式,怎么用手机给自己拍摄的视频加上字幕?安卓手机视频编辑器给视频加字幕的方法...
- C++常用函数汇总(持续更新)
- 【SLAM】2019浙大SLAM暑期学校--刘浩敏《集束调整》学习记录
- 计算机上自带的打字游戏,在学校上电脑课打字游戏的日子
- Axure RP8 下载、安装、破解、汉化一条龙服务
- Date: 7 Dec, Saturday 佳能交流空间
- Android Studio过滤冗余日志
- RabbitMq无法访问http://localhost:1567,Failed to start Ranch listener {acceptor,{0,0,0,0,0,0,0,0},5672解决
热门文章
- 基于Docker搭建GitLab代码管理
- TabLayout中的Tab.setCustomView左右有空隙,TabLayout下划线间隙设置,下划线长度设置
- Android 实现ListView的A-Z字母排序
- ubuntu navicat删除目录破解如何保留配置信息
- three.js script vertex和fragment在react中使用/纯js写法
- ie6/7 position relative overflow
- js jquery Ajax同步
- python3交互模式下 按上翻箭头显示乱码_CentOS 6.3中,Python-2.7.3交互模式下方向键、退格键等出现乱码...
- 各版本lettuce spring集成流程(连接池、哨兵配置)
- unity2018关联不到vs_现实VS真爱:远嫁的幸福和悲哀